The clever illusion that tricks your brain
What makes this puzzle so effective is a simple mental shortcut our brains love to take. We’re wired to focus on what’s most obvious. When a clearly visible cat sits front and center, bathed in light, our attention locks onto it. Everything else fades into the background. It’s similar to how a brightly lit store display draws your eye away from subtler details. The second cat relies entirely on this distraction. Hidden in plain sight, it escapes notice simply because your brain assumes it has already found what it was looking for.

How can you sharpen your observation skills?
You don’t need intense training to get better at these puzzles. Small habits make a big difference. Try changing your viewing angle, slowing down before jumping to conclusions, or paying attention to repeating shapes and patterns around you. Over time, these playful adjustments naturally improve your visual awareness—often without you even noticing the improvement happening.
